AONL and 62 other members of the Nursing Community Coalition urged Congress to pass shared legislative priorities affecting nursing education, workforce and research before the 118th Congress ends.

Certain health care-acquired infections continued to decrease, according to an annual progress report released by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ention.

The nursing shortage has caused colleges to increase efforts to attract more men to the profession and ensure they feel supported to continue their nursing careers long term.
A virtual simulation with an interprofessional debriefing encouraged nurse and medical residents at Children’s National Hospital in Washington, D.C. to collaborate and discuss safety topics away from the stress of the bedside, a study found.
A virtual nursing pilot program focused on discharge and patient education increased patient and nurse satisfaction while reducing turnover and adverse events, according to a Journal of Nursing Administration study.
